作者:Helfat, Constance E.; Maritan, Catherine A.
作者单位:Dartmouth College; Syracuse University
摘要:Research suggests that multibusiness firms often misallocate financial resources. However, research also suggests that firms differ in how effectively they allocate a range of resources. We argue that some firms have a resource allocation capability that enables them to more effectively determine the allocation of resources than often portrayed in the literature. We identify key search and selection routines that form the building blocks of a resource allocation capability and explain how thes...

作者:Grandy, Jake B.; Hiatt, Shon R.
作者单位:University of Arkansas System; University of Arkansas Fayetteville; University of Southern California
摘要:Although scholarship has highlighted how stakeholders can influence business outcomes, few studies have examined how simultaneous, different tactics interact to impact firms. Critical to understanding this interaction is the radical flank effect, which asserts that the moderate and radical elements of social activist tactics can interact to either enhance or diminish a movement's ability to accomplish its goals. However, research is unclear about when and whether the radical flank effect enhan...

作者:Chang, Sea-Jin; Kim, Young-Choon; Park, Sangchan
作者单位:National University of Singapore; Korea Advanced Institute of Science & Technology (KAIST); Ulsan National Institute of Science & Technology (UNIST)
摘要:Building on the literature on resource reconfiguration theory, we formulate a new theoretical framework that explains how executive redeployment within a diversified firm transfers different types of human capital embodied in executives to different units facing specific business challenges. In the empirical context of Korean business groups, we find that executives with unit-specific human capital, like turnaround experience, competitive experience, and international expansion experience, are...

作者:Keum, Daniel Dongil; Ryan, Stephen
作者单位:Columbia University
摘要:We provide evidence that in certain contexts, firms set upward-striving goals and that this upward striving yields significant performance and visibility benefits. We develop a model of variable attention in which, as firms' performance levels approach cognitively salient round numbers, managers strategically shift their focus from easier-toreach goals based on historical and social reference points to more challenging goals that provide external visibility and capital market benefits. As one ...
